What companies run services between Bologna, Italy and Luton, England?

Ryanair flies from Bologna Guglielmo Marconi Airport (BLQ) to Luton Airport (LTN) 4 times a week. Alternatively, you can take a train from Bologna centrale to Luton via Milano Centrale, Lyon Part Dieu, Lille Europe, and London St Pancras Intl in around 13h 5m.
